Utah Retirement Systems's Q1 2015 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2015, Utah Retirement Systems held 1,028 positions worth $3.81B, up 4.6% from $3.64B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 15% of the portfolio.

Utah Retirement Systems deployed $130M of net new capital in Q1 2015, opening 12 new positions and adding to 945 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Vista Outdoor Inc.: 11,220 shares worth $481K.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Healthcare at 15% of assets, up from 14%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Technology.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was Time Warner Inc, an estimated $332K trimmed.
